Where each one falls short

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.

Captivate

  • Tiers are download ceilings and nothing else: 30,000 a month on Personal, 150,000 on Professional and 300,000 on Business
  • A show that exceeds its allowance for two consecutive months is expected to move up a tier
  • Above 300,000 downloads a month the plan is quote-only
  • Prices are quoted in euros at the yearly rate

Contentful

  • Pricing model with content type limits (48) forces full tier upgrades
  • Limited GraphQL mutations for content management complexity
  • Requires significant technical expertise and developer dependency
  • Uncertainty following Salesforce acquisition announcement in June 2026

Contentful: What is the difference between Contentful and traditional CMS platforms?

Contentful is a headless CMS that decouples content from presentation, allowing you to deliver the same content across websites, mobile apps, IoT devices, and voice assistants without duplication.

Contentful: How does Contentful handle multi-locale content?

Contentful supports multi-locale content, though multi-locale costs must be negotiated upfront depending on your pricing tier and requirements.

Source
Contentful: Does Contentful integrate with e-commerce platforms?

Yes, Contentful partners with Commerce Layer, an API-first commerce platform, to enable enterprise-grade e-commerce experiences alongside headless CMS capabilities.
